Editing Server Settings

The first step in customizing your Bedrock server is to edit the server settings. This can be done by opening the server.properties file in a text editor and making the desired changes. Here are some examples of settings you can adjust:

  • server-name: This sets the name of your server that appears in the server list.
  • server-port: This sets the port that your server listens on for incoming connections.
  • gamemode: This sets the default game mode for new players.
  • difficulty: This sets the default difficulty level for new players.
